Project Overview
The project focuses on the development and application of plastic transparent granules specifically for shoe lighting systems. These granules are designed to enhance the aesthetic appeal of footwear by integrating LED lighting features. The utilization of transparent plastics, such as Acrylic and PET, allows for optimal light diffusion and durability, which are critical for maintaining the shoe's functionality and appeal. This innovative approach not only targets fashion-conscious consumers but also opens avenues for safety features in footwear for various industries. The production process involves advanced techniques like Injection Moulding and Extrusion, ensuring high-quality output and scalability. As global trends gravitate towards smart wearable technology, the demand for visually appealing and functional designs in footwear equipped with lighting systems is expected to rise significantly. This project aims to position itself advantageously within the competitive landscape of the plastic manufacturing sector, contributing to a greener environment by utilizing recyclable materials.

SWOT Analysis
Strengths
- High quality and durability of transparent granules.
- Innovative design features appealing to modern consumers.
- Scalability of production processes.
Weaknesses
- Higher initial manufacturing costs.
- Limited awareness in traditional footwear markets.
- Dependence on the performance of LED technology.
Opportunities
- Rising trends in sustainable and eco-friendly products.
- Potential for international market expansion.
- Collaboration with fashion brands for exclusive collections.
Threats
- Intense competition from established plastic manufacturers.
- Rapid technological advancements in lighting systems.
- Regulatory challenges related to material safety and environmental standards.

How much investment is required?
Total capital investment ranges from ₹3,850,000 to ₹68,250,000 depending on the scale of operation. This covers plant and machinery, civil work, pre-operative expenses, and working capital. Larger scales require proportionally higher investment but typically offer better returns.
When does this project break even?
At the larger investment scale, the expected break-even is approximately approx. 5 years at approximately 55.00% capacity utilisation. Smaller setups may reach break-even sooner due to lower fixed costs relative to the capacity.
